Porto face AVS in Liga Portugal on Monday, 29 December 2025 at the Estádio Do Dragão, with the hosts looking to tighten their grip on top spot and the visitors fighting to climb off the foot of the table.
Porto have dominated the head-to-head, winning both previous league meetings against AVS, 5-0 away and 2-0 at home. First play 18th here, framing a clear title charge versus survival context.
Form backs up that picture. Porto are unbeaten in the league with 14 wins and one draw from 15, and they've posted 11 clean sheets. AVS are winless in the league but did draw 2-2 with Nacional last time out after heavy defeats to Vitória S.C. and Sporting CP.
The numbers point to contrasting profiles. Porto have scored 33 and conceded four in the league, averaging 55% possession with 85.44% passing accuracy. Their wide supply is consistent, with 170 open-play crosses at 21.76% accuracy and five headed goals, while Samu Aghehowa has nine league goals. AVS have scored 11 and shipped 39, average 43% possession, are yet to keep a clean sheet and have conceded six penalties. The hosts could look to control territory and use deliveries into the box, while the visitors may have to play on transitions.
A win would lift Porto to 46 points and further strengthen their lead in the title race. Victory for AVS would move them to seven points and could inject momentum into a survival bid in the relegation places.
